    This place attracts folks from all walks of life, young and old. Car parking is across the street in fact it is a significant challenge. Chairs and tables are restricted but start is fast which means you just need to end up being on the hunt and get thenext empty table. It really is a patio area so be ready for the warm weather or when it rains for example. Food choices are lots so bring a clear stomach.

    The place comprises small stalls selling different types of cuisine from various areas of asia. We'd tikka masala quessadillas, sisig from bagnet, kaboom fries, sukiyaki and seafood udon and most of us enjoyed and liked them. We also enjoyed the iced tea toshare, it had been very novel and the iced tea tasted great. The waffle cone really was excellent, but was dissatisfied with the 7th component nitrogen ice lotion which tasted like flour. If you are following a quick, inexpensive but great meal, Gastro Recreation area is really a better alternative. I will not at all mind going back.

    I had high expectations with this particular food park since i have have been likely to eat here for such a long time (hype and all). Us went right here on a Sunday night time and I was amazed there weren't way too many people. Furthermore, not absolutely all stalls were open up,and parking is usually to be paid. It was furthermore hot here because it's only a small, open region, but great to notice fans and atmosphere coolers around. They will have a number of foodstuff, from tempuras, to beef masala, fries and buffalo poultry, to cucumber beverages and shakes. We attempted the Filipino seafood fiesta in one of the stalls (a range of grilled squid, shrimp, salmon head sinigang, barbecue) nonetheless it was prepared with nothing at all too special. a few of the products were even undercooked. Positive thing we purchased the tempura, which tasted good. A great spot to bond with relatives and buddies, but make sure to arrive early otherwise, car parking and finding a desk will both be considered a challenge.
